About This Access Site
**Location & Facilities**
The Oak Hill Road boat ramp provides public access to Toledo Bend Reservoir on the Texas side near Hemphill in Sabine County. This two-lane ramp is located within Sabine National Forest and accommodates all boat types, including kayaks and canoes. There are no launch fees and no courtesy docks available at this site.
